The longest league season in football history is finally in the books after the shortest possible run to the finish line.
92 games were crammed into just 39 days as the Premier League not only resumed the 2019/20 campaign amid coronavirus against all odds but also completed it.
It looked for a long while like we would never get started again, let alone finish.
